Title: Ratification by the Board of Education of a Professional Services Contract between the District and Luna Kids Dance, Berkeley, CA, for the latter using the District's Guide: Dance Learning in the 21st Century: a Blueprint for Teaching & Learning Dance Grades K-12(c)2010, Revised, the latter will use the former to integrate Common Core arts standards, to create progressive curriculum aligned with the National Core Arts Standards and work with partner teachers in a side-by-side collaborative model to recover some of the gaps developed in the dance program over the past two years; use goals of the dance program to align with the school goals of improving literacy through the arts at New Highland Academy, for the period of September 1, 2015 through June 9, 2016, in an amount not to exceed $15,000.00.
